A revision of the current state-of-the-art adaptive optics technology for visual sciences is provided.

The human eye, as an optical system able to generate images onto the retina, exhibits optical aberrations.

Those are continuously changing with time, and they are different for every subject.

Adaptive optics is the technology permitting the manipulation of the aberrations, and eventually their correction.

Across the different applications of adaptive optics, the current paper focuses on visual simulation.

These systems are capable of manipulating the ocular aberrations and simultaneous visual testing though the modified aberrations on real eyes.

Some applications of the visual simulators presented in this work are the study of the neural adaptation to the aberrations, the influence of aberrations on accommodation, and the recent development of binocular adaptive optics visual simulators allowing the study of stereopsis.
